标准摘要
[中文适用范围]: 本IEC 60068的第2-65部分提供了标准程序和指南,用于进行声学测试,以确定试件承受或可能承受的指定声压级环境引起的振动能力。对于声压级环境低于120 dB的情况,通常不需要进行声学测试。本标准确定试件的机械弱点和/或性能退化,并利用此信息,结合相关规范,决定其是否可接受用于使用。测试方法也可用作确定试件机械鲁棒性或抗疲劳性的手段。描述了两种进行测试以及在声噪声场中测量声压级的程序,并考虑了在试件指定点测量振动响应的需要。它还提供了选择声噪声环境、频谱、声压级和暴露时间的指南。行波管法适用于气动湍流将激励部分或全部外表面的材料。此类应用包括飞机面板组件,其中激励仅存在于一侧。混响室法适用于宜通过分布式激励而非通过电动激振器的固定点将振动诱导到设备整个外表面的情况。 [外文原描述]: IEC 60068-2-65:2013 provides standard procedures and guidance for conducting acoustic tests in order to determine the ability of a specimen to withstand vibration caused by a specified sound-pressure level environment to which it is, or is liable to be, subjected. This second edition cancels and replaces the second edition, published in 1993, and constitutes a technical revision. This edition includes the following significant technical changes with respect to the previous edition: - minor technical and editorial changes were made throughout the document as originally requested by the DE National Committee; - following comments at the CD stage, particularly from the UK National Committee, significant technical and editorial additions were made to the standard for acoustic testing employing the progressive wave tube technique.
